The Perfect Storm:
9 out of 10 people want to be cared for at home when terminally ill.
Death is the number 1 fear in the world.
People come on hospice services very late in their process.
It is a culmination of these factors that are heavily contributing to end of life not going well for most. It is time to change that.
As a former hospice and oncology nurse, who has had the honor and privilege to have worked with over 1,000 people at the end of life, I can tell you that the answer to end of life not going well is to bring back the truth about death (how it is a natural and sacred experience) and to teach family caregivers the skill of how to care for someone who is dying BEFORE they ever need it.
